الحمد لله الذي بنعمته تتم الصالحات، والصلاة والسلام على عبده ورسوله المبعوث رحمة للعالمين وعلى آله وصحبه أجمعين؛ وبعد:
درسنا اليوم عن العمليات الحسابيه والمنطقية.
                               عمل الطالب : خالد سلمان العانسي
                               شعبة : 104
                                أشراف المعلم : زياد الجهني






أولا: العمليات الحسابية في البرمجة :
تحتوي جميع لغات البرمجة على عمليات الحساب الاساسية : الجمع والطرح والضرب والقسمة والاس. وتختلف طريقة كتابة المعادلات الحسابية عن الطريقة الجبرية كما هو موضح في الجدول التالي :



ويجب أن يكون لدينا قوانين نتبعها لنعرف اي العمليات تنفذ اولا.

اولاً: ترتيب العمليات الحسابية :
1: العمليات التي في داخل القوس
2: عمليات ألاس
3: عمليات الضرب والقسمة ، وإذا تعددت نبدأ من اليسار إلى اليمين.
4: عمليات الجمع والطرح ، وإذا تعددت نبدأ من اليسار إلى اليمين.








ثانياً: العمليات المنطقية ف البرمجة :
ويقصد بها العمليات التي يتم فيها المقارنة بين قيميتن ، سواء اكنانتا حرفين او عددين ، متساووين او غير متساووين ، او احداهما اكبر او اصغر من الاخرى . ويوضح الجدول التالي عمليات المقارنة المستخدمة في (فيجوال بيسك ستديو) :



يكون الناتج في عمليات المقارنة إما القيمة (true)اي : صحيح أو (False)أي : خطاء.
لو كان لدينا عمليات حسابية ومعها عملية مقارنة فإن أولوية التنفيذ تكون للعمليات الحسابية.




ثالثاً: تحويل المعادلات الجبرية إلى الصيغة المستخدمة في البرمجة :
لاحظنا عند دراسة العمليات الحسابية أن طريقة كتابتها بالصيغة الجبرية تختلف عن طريقة كتابتها بالصيغة البرمجية. وعند قيامك بخطوة صياغة خل المسألة فغالباً ماتكون العمليات الحسابية مكتوبة بالصيغة الجبرية؛ لذلك يجب عليك عند كتابة البرنامج تحويل العمليات الحسابية من الصيغة الجبرية إلى الصيغة البرمجية.






                   ♤والسلام عليكم ورحمة الله وبركاتة♤

تعليقات

  1. السلام عليكم و رحمة الله و بركاته أشكركم على عملكم النير هذا لكني أطلب منكم في رجاء أن أعطوني تعريف العمليات المنطقية بأسرع وقت ممكن لو سمحتم و شكرا🤗😎

    ردحذف

إرسال تعليق